Description
Pont Pen y Llyn bridge was built in 1826 to connect the Fachwen slate quarry to the main road from Caernarfon to Llanberis. It has four arches and crosses the river Rhythallt, the outlet of Padarn lake. Pen y Llyn means “end of the lake”.
The lake is a glacially formed lake in Snowdonia, Gwynedd, north Wales, UK
